My vehicle incorrectly read highway number signs as though they were speed limit signs. This occurred eight times on state highway [XXX] in Florida; and once on state highway [XXX]. The speed limit was actually 55 mph on highway [XXX]. If I would have had “Predictive Speed Assist” turned on, and was using adaptive cruise control, it would have automatically decelerated to 40, +/- whatever “tolerance” I had set. What would happen if this occurs on highway 80, or highway 100? Acceleration to 100 mph, and possibly to 120 mph if I had the tolerance set to +20? This error, which happened while I was a passenger, could significantly exacerbate problem #1. See details in the attached 5 page pdf. Several symptoms occur: Car goes into deep sleep mode after an hour sitting idle. Car fails to start, with all warning lights active on dashboard. Dome lights don't turn on and remote features not allowed due to low battery. This is related to non-AGM 12V batteries being installed in the 2020, 2022, and 2023 Hybrid Escape. 2021's have the AGM battery and there are no problems reported on the forums regarding this issue for that model year. This is a serious safety concern as the winters get colder, and engines not starting on a brand new vehicle is a matter of life and death. Please investigate this issue, as Ford dealers claim there is noting wrong, and they refuse to install the AGM batteries. A TSB is needed to resolve this problem for all customers.
